A typical post picks up 1.1K interactions against 512K followers, an engagement rate of 0.217%. Measured over 10 original posts, its engagement rate beats 81% of 6,874 tracked accounts of a similar size. Comparing inside a size band matters here: engagement rate falls as accounts grow, so a raw rate would mostly just re-measure the follower count. Posts are seen about 22K times each, and 5.05% of those impressions turn into an interaction. That is about 4.29% of the follower count, which is the gap between an audience on paper and an audience in a timeline. Posting runs at about 2.9 posts a day over the last 30 days, though only 17% of days saw any activity at all. Most posts go out around 17:00 UTC, and Saturday is the busiest day of the week. Of the 10 posts sampled, 90% carry an image or video, 10% are part of a thread and 30% link out. The account's strongest tracked post pulled 35K interactions, about 32x its own typical post. Formats this account uses

Its own posting mix on the left, and what each of those formats does across every account we track on the right. Only formats where the effect clears our publish test appear here, so an empty row is a format we could not measure rather than one that does nothing.

This account's posting mix compared with catalog-wide effects
FormatThis accountCatalog effect95% intervalAccounts behind it
Image or video90% of posts+111%+108% to +115%34K
Outbound link30% of posts-41%-42% to -40%32K
Typical length-+15%+14% to +16%32K
  • 90% of this account's sampled posts carry an image or video. Across the catalog, posts with an image or video run 111% above the same accounts' other posts.
  • 30% of its posts carry a link off X. Across the catalog, posts with an outbound link run 41% below the same accounts' other posts.
  • Its average post runs 435 characters, which falls in the over 280 characters band. Across the catalog, posts over 280 characters run 15% above the same accounts' other posts.

These are catalog-wide differences applied to this account's own posting mix, not a measurement of how each format performs for this account specifically. We keep one median per account, not one per format per account, so the second thing is not something this data can tell you.
